| ¶Ô±ÈÐÂÎļþ |
| | |
| | | import request from '@/utils/request'
|
| | |
|
| | | // æ¥è¯¢è§è²å表
|
| | | export function listRole(query) {
|
| | | return request({
|
| | | url: '/system/role/list',
|
| | | method: 'get',
|
| | | params: query
|
| | | })
|
| | | }
|
| | |
|
| | | // æ¥è¯¢è§è²è¯¦ç»
|
| | | export function getRole(roleId) {
|
| | | return request({
|
| | | url: '/system/role/' + roleId,
|
| | | method: 'get'
|
| | | })
|
| | | }
|
| | |
|
| | | // æ°å¢è§è²
|
| | | export function addRole(data) {
|
| | | return request({
|
| | | url: '/system/role',
|
| | | method: 'post',
|
| | | data: data
|
| | | })
|
| | | }
|
| | |
|
| | | // ä¿®æ¹è§è²
|
| | | export function updateRole(data) {
|
| | | return request({
|
| | | url: '/system/role',
|
| | | method: 'put',
|
| | | data: data
|
| | | })
|
| | | }
|
| | |
|
| | | // è§è²æ°æ®æé
|
| | | export function dataScope(data) {
|
| | | return request({
|
| | | url: '/system/role/dataScope',
|
| | | method: 'put',
|
| | | data: data
|
| | | })
|
| | | }
|
| | |
|
| | | // è§è²ç¶æä¿®æ¹
|
| | | export function changeRoleStatus(roleId, status) {
|
| | | const data = {
|
| | | roleId,
|
| | | status
|
| | | }
|
| | | return request({
|
| | | url: '/system/role/changeStatus',
|
| | | method: 'put',
|
| | | data: data
|
| | | })
|
| | | }
|
| | |
|
| | | // å é¤è§è²
|
| | | export function delRole(roleId) {
|
| | | return request({
|
| | | url: '/system/role/' + roleId,
|
| | | method: 'delete'
|
| | | })
|
| | | }
|
| | |
|
| | | // æ¥è¯¢è§è²å·²ææç¨æ·å表
|
| | | export function allocatedUserList(query) {
|
| | | return request({
|
| | | url: '/system/role/authUser/allocatedList',
|
| | | method: 'get',
|
| | | params: query
|
| | | })
|
| | | }
|
| | |
|
| | | // æ¥è¯¢è§è²æªææç¨æ·å表
|
| | | export function unallocatedUserList(query) {
|
| | | return request({
|
| | | url: '/system/role/authUser/unallocatedList',
|
| | | method: 'get',
|
| | | params: query
|
| | | })
|
| | | }
|
| | |
|
| | | // åæ¶ç¨æ·ææè§è²
|
| | | export function authUserCancel(data) {
|
| | | return request({
|
| | | url: '/system/role/authUser/cancel',
|
| | | method: 'put',
|
| | | data: data
|
| | | })
|
| | | }
|
| | |
|
| | | // æ¹éåæ¶ç¨æ·ææè§è²
|
| | | export function authUserCancelAll(data) {
|
| | | return request({
|
| | | url: '/system/role/authUser/cancelAll',
|
| | | method: 'put',
|
| | | params: data
|
| | | })
|
| | | }
|
| | |
|
| | | // ææç¨æ·éæ©
|
| | | export function authUserSelectAll(data) {
|
| | | return request({
|
| | | url: '/system/role/authUser/selectAll',
|
| | | method: 'put',
|
| | | params: data
|
| | | })
|
| | | }
|
| | |
|
| | | // æ ¹æ®è§è²IDæ¥è¯¢é¨é¨æ ç»æ
|
| | | export function deptTreeSelect(roleId) {
|
| | | return request({
|
| | | url: '/system/role/deptTree/' + roleId,
|
| | | method: 'get'
|
| | | })
|
| | | }
|